‘HE NAMED ME MALALA’ NOMINATED FOR FIVE EMMY AWARDS

Nominations include Outstanding Director nod for Davis Guggenheim

This weekend it was announced that our international co-production, He Named Me Malala was nominated for five Emmy Awards.

Released in 2015 to critical acclaim, He Named Me Malala is the intimate portrait of Nobel Peace Prize Laureate Malala Yousafzai, who was targeted by the Taliban and severely wounded by a gunshot when returning home on her school bus in Pakistan’s Swat Valley. The film was directed by Academy® Award-winning filmmaker Davis Guggenheim (An Inconvenient Truth and Waiting for “Superman”), produced by Parkes/MacDonald and distributed by Fox Searchlight Pictures in association with Image Nation Abu Dhabi, Participant Media and National Geographic Channel.

 

The nominations include, Outstanding Production Design For A Variety, Nonfiction, Event Or Award Special, Outstanding Cinematography For A Nonfiction Program, Outstanding Directing For A Nonfiction Program, Outstanding Picture Editing For A Nonfiction Program and Outstanding Sound Editing For A Nonfiction Program (Single Or Multi-Camera) .

 

The winners will be announced at an award ceremony on September 18.
